As expected, the Cincinnati Bengals won’t risk Joe Burrow during the team’s preseason opener against the Tampa Bay Buccaneers.

Though Burrow sounds like a guy who wants nothing more than to suit up for something like Saturday’s game, Zac Taylor has made the call.

“But at the end of the day it’s not my decision and I don’t get paid to make that decision. I get paid to play quarterback,” Burrow said, according to Geoff Hobson of Bengals.com.

Taylor did reveal, though, that running back Joe Mixon will be a go for at least a little while as the team looks to get his game legs back under him. Mixon says he was 100 percent earlier this year after an injury limited him to six games last season.

Otherwise, nothing shocking on the attendance front — the Bengals won’t risk guys with nagging issues and the opener should largely be a proving ground for guys on the roster bubble.
